directions

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.
  • In a large bowl, sift together flour, baking soda, baking powder, salt, and ginger.
  • Stir in apricots, applesauce, maple syrup, juice, vanilla, vinegar, and nuts.
  • Mix together until"just mixed".
  • Spoon batter into oiled loaf pan and bake for 50 minutes.
